Yes — the Gaudi 3 128GB (128 GB HBM2e) can run gpt-oss-20b. At Q4 with the default 8K context it needs ≈ 13.55 GB VRAM (weights 11.83 GB + KV cache 0.72 GB + 1 GB runtime overhead), which fits within 128 GB. Decode at Q4/8K: ≈ 579.1 tok/s (estimated, batch 1). FP16 (≈ 44.72 GB) also fits, at ≈ 159.2 tok/s (estimated). Estimates come from memory-bandwidth math; rows tagged measured override estimates. Relative ranking is more reliable than absolute tok/s. Methodology.
